Dr. Amit Ghose selected medicine as a career alternative after an enjoyable schooling at St. Xaviers Collegiate School. He graduated and post-graduated from Calcutta Medical College. Subsequently, he proceeded to the United Kingdom and trained between 1987 and 1996. He returned to Calcutta where he has set up a comprehensive urological service in the private sector.
After his return from the UK, he has been associated with various institutions including Wockhardt Hospital and Kidney Institute, Woodlands Hospital, Kothari Medical Center, and Anandalok Hospital. Currently, he has dedicated his service to Apollo Gleneagles Hospitals, Kolkata.
The early part of the career journey witnessed Dr. Amit Ghose developing the general Urological service for the community of West Bengal mainly on the platform of Wockhardt Hospital. Then he set up his own private practice by establishing The Oxford Stone Clinic. This enabled him to make healthcare affordable for all strata of Society.
Apart from being a doctor and surgeon, Dr. Ghose felt the necessity to give back to the society he belongs to. He founded the Bengal Urology Trust and Prostate Cancer Foundation in Kolkata. He is the emeritus health committee chairperson of the Bengal Chamber of Commerce. Through these organizations, he organizes periodical awareness campaigns on Urological diseases in general and Prostate (Cancer) in particular so that people after certain years of age become aware of good practice of urological health.
Many other activities have been organized for the benefit of Urological patients, the general public, and charitable organizations. Dr. Amit Ghose has been the Chairperson of The Bengal Chamber of Commerce & Industry since 2003. He has been instrumental in conducting various public interests health camps, awareness programs, and education policy-making Seminars. As the Chairperson of the Prostate Cancer Foundation, Kolkata he has spearheaded a number of campaigns to promote the cause of awareness of Prostate Cancer for the benefit of the lay public. Many useful Urological Seminars have been conducted on the platform of Rotary and Lions for the benefit of the Society in general.

Qualifications
M.B.B.S., Calcutta University, India (1982)
M.S., Calcutta University, India (1986)
F.R.C.S., Royal College of Surgeons, Edinburgh (1990)
Diploma in Urology, University College Hospitals, London (1994)
General Education
St. Xavier’s Collegiate School, Calcutta (1963 – 1974)
Higher Secondary Certificate (1975) West Bengal Board of Secondary Education
Undergraduate Education
Maulana Azad College, Calcutta. Premedical Education (1975-1976)
Medical College Hospitals, Calcutta Medical School (1976-1982) Internship (1982 – 1983)
MBBS (Calcutta University April 1983)
Post Graduate Education
Calcutta Medical College (1984 – 1986)
MS General Surgery, Calcutta University (1986)
FRCS Ed, Royal College of Surgeons, Edinburgh (1990)
Diploma in Urology, University College Hospitals, London (1994)
Various Hospital Appointments in the U.K. (1986 – 1995)

Appointments In UK
Started training at Princess Royal Hospital, Telford, Royal Shrewsbury Hospital and Whipps Cross Hospital, London. (1990-1991)
Proceeded to work as Registrar and Sr. Registrar at Churchill-John Radcliffe Hospital, Oxford. Gained special experience in Renal Transplantation in this job.
Worked as Sr. Registrar at Wordsley Hospital, Midlands
Appointments In India
Started working as Consultant at Wockhardt Medical Centre and Wockhardt Hospital and Kidney Institute (1996 – 2001)
Worked at Woodlands Hospital (2001 – 2003)
Currently working at Apollo Gleneagles Hospitals, Gariahat & Apollo Gleneagles Hospitals, EM Byepass since 2003 till date
